Abstract:
A method for running multiple copies of the same native code in a Java Virtual Machine is described. In one embodiment, such a method includes providing a class to enable segregating multiple copies of the same native code. The method defines, within the class, a native method configured to dispatch operation of the native code. The method further includes generating first and second instances of the class. Calling the native method in the first instance causes a first copy of the native code to run in a first remote execution container (e.g., a first process). Similarly, calling the native method in the second instance causes a second copy of the native code to run in a second remote execution container (e.g., a second process) separate from the first remote execution container. A corresponding computer program product is also disclosed.
